
Ingredients :
4 tomatoes
40z/115g of canned tuna - drain
10 green olives - chopped
2 shallots - chopped
1 tbsp of lemon juice
1/4 cup of low fat mayonnaise
1 tbsp of mustard
1 tbsp of tomato sauce
Salt and pepper to taste

2) Place it on a baking dish.
3) Mix all the rest of the ingredient well and spoon the tuna into the tomato shells.
4) Bake in a pre-heated 350 degree F oven for 20 min.
5) Serve warm or chilled.
Note : I didn't add any salt to it because the tuna is salty.
